How much grain can this container hold?

Mathematics
2 answers:
ludmilkaskok [199]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

953.78 in^3 of grain.

Step-by-step explanation:

The volume of a cylinder = π r^2 h.

For this cylinder r =  radius of the base = 9/2

= 4.5 in  and the height h = 15 in

So the volume is 3.14 * 4.5^2 * 15

= 953.78 in^3.

If the pre-image (4,-3) is translated &lt;-6,-8&gt; the image will be located at: (?,?)
liubo4ka [24]

Answer:

(-2, - 11)

Step-by-step explanation:

Coordinate of preimage = (4, - 3)

Pre image is translated <-6,-8>

X - coordinate of preimage = 4

Translation, x coordinate + (-6)

Y - coordinate of preimage = - 3

Translation, x coordinate + (-8)

Image will be located at (4+(-6) ; - 3+(-8))

Hence, we have (-2, - 11)
